Basement Cleaning Service in Frisco, TX
Basement cleaning services focus on thoroughly removing dirt, debris, and accumulated grime from all areas of a basement space. This includes clearing out clutter, vacuuming and sweeping floors, wiping down surfaces, and addressing any signs of mold, mildew, or moisture buildup. Such projects are often requested when homeowners want to refresh their basement, prepare it for storage or finishing, or simply maintain a clean and healthy environment in their home’s lower level.
Property owners typically seek basement cleaning services before undertaking renovation projects, converting the space into a livable area, or when preparing for seasonal changes. It’s important to understand the scope of work, including whether the service covers cleaning of storage areas, utility zones, or finished living spaces. Clarifying any specific concerns, such as mold removal or odor control, can help ensure the service meets individual needs and results in a clean, well-maintained basement.

Basement Cleaning Service Questions
What areas are covered by basement cleaning services? Services typically cover residential properties in Frisco, TX, and nearby neighborhoods, focusing on thorough cleaning of basement spaces.
What types of basement cleaning projects are commonly requested? Common projects include removing dirt and debris, mold and mildew cleaning, and preparing basements for storage or renovation.
Is basement cleaning suitable for all basement types? Yes, services are adaptable to various basement finishes, including concrete, drywall, and finished spaces.
What should property owners know before scheduling basement cleaning? It's important to clear the area of personal belongings and inform about any existing moisture or mold issues beforehand.
